Water management (sprinkler irrigation) in blackgram query

Blackgram, also known as urad bean, is an important pulse crop grown throughout the Indian subcontinent. It is a rich source of protein, fiber, and essential nutrients like iron, magnesium, and potassium. However, blackgram cultivation is challenging due to its sensitivity to moisture stress. To ensure optimal yield and quality, farmers need to adopt efficient water management practices, such as sprinkler irrigation.

Sprinkler irrigation is a method of crop irrigation that involves the application of water in a uniform manner over the entire field using overhead sprinklers. This method is more efficient than traditional flood irrigation, as it minimizes water loss due to evaporation, runoff, and deep percolation. Moreover, it allows farmers to apply water at the right time and in the right quantities to meet the crop’s water requirements.

One of the key benefits of sprinkler irrigation in blackgram cultivation is that it helps to maintain soil moisture levels at the root zone. Blackgram requires a well-drained, loamy soil with a pH range of 6.0 to 7.5. Excessive waterlogging or drought can affect the plant’s growth and development, leading to yield losses. With sprinkler irrigation, farmers can control the amount of water applied and provide the crop with a consistent supply of moisture, even during dry spells.

Another advantage of sprinkler irrigation in blackgram cultivation is its ability to help manage weeds, pests, and diseases. By applying water evenly over the field, sprinklers can reduce the chances of weed germination and minimize the spread of insect and fungal infestations. Additionally, sprinkler irrigation can help to reduce heat stress on the plant, which can improve its resilience to pest and disease attacks.

However, to get the most out of sprinkler irrigation in blackgram cultivation, farmers need to follow some best practices. Firstly, they need to select the right sprinkler system based on their field size, soil type, and water availability. A well-designed system should have adequate pressure, distribution uniformity, and energy efficiency to ensure efficient water use. Secondly, farmers need to implement proper scheduling based on the crop’s growth stage, soil moisture levels, and weather conditions. This can help to avoid overwatering, which can lead to leaching of nutrients and soil erosion. Lastly, farmers should also consider using mulch or cover crops to retain soil moisture and improve soil health.

In conclusion, water management using sprinkler irrigation is a critical factor in blackgram cultivation. It can help farmers to improve crop productivity, reduce water wastage, and manage pests and diseases. By adopting efficient water management practices and investing in sprinkler irrigation systems, farmers can ensure a sustainable and profitable blackgram production system.
